| package android.keystore.cts; |
| |
| import android.security.keystore.KeyProperties; |
| import android.security.keystore.KeyProtection; |
| import android.test.MoreAsserts; |
| |
| import junit.framework.TestCase; |
| |
| import java.util.Arrays; |
| import java.util.Date; |
| |
| public class KeyProtectionTest extends TestCase { |
| public void testDefaults() { |
| // Set only the mandatory parameters and assert values returned by getters. |
| |
| KeyProtection spec = new KeyProtection.Builder(KeyProperties.PURPOSE_ENCRYPT) |
| .build(); |
| |
| assertEquals(KeyProperties.PURPOSE_ENCRYPT, spec.getPurposes()); |
| MoreAsserts.assertEmpty(Arrays.asList(spec.getBlockModes())); |
| assertFalse(spec.isDigestsSpecified()); |
| try { |
| spec.getDigests(); |
| fail(); |
| } catch (IllegalStateException expected) {} |
| MoreAsserts.assertEmpty(Arrays.asList(spec.getEncryptionPaddings())); |
| assertNull(spec.getKeyValidityStart()); |
| assertNull(spec.getKeyValidityForOriginationEnd()); |
| assertNull(spec.getKeyValidityForConsumptionEnd()); |
| assertTrue(spec.isRandomizedEncryptionRequired()); |
| MoreAsserts.assertEmpty(Arrays.asList(spec.getSignaturePaddings())); |
| assertFalse(spec.isUserAuthenticationRequired()); |
| assertEquals(-1, spec.getUserAuthenticationValidityDurationSeconds()); |
| } |
| |
| public void testSettersReflectedInGetters() { |
| // Set all parameters to non-default values and then assert that getters reflect that. |
| |
| Date keyValidityStartDate = new Date(System.currentTimeMillis() - 2222222); |
| Date keyValidityEndDateForOrigination = new Date(System.currentTimeMillis() + 11111111); |
| Date keyValidityEndDateForConsumption = new Date(System.currentTimeMillis() + 33333333); |
| |
| KeyProtection spec = new KeyProtection.Builder( |
| KeyProperties.PURPOSE_DECRYPT | KeyProperties.PURPOSE_VERIFY) |
| .setBlockModes(KeyProperties.BLOCK_MODE_GCM, KeyProperties.BLOCK_MODE_CTR) |
| .setDigests(KeyProperties.DIGEST_SHA256, KeyProperties.DIGEST_SHA512) |
| .setEncryptionPaddings(KeyProperties.ENCRYPTION_PADDING_RSA_PKCS1, |
| KeyProperties.ENCRYPTION_PADDING_PKCS7) |
| .setKeyValidityStart(keyValidityStartDate) |
| .setKeyValidityForOriginationEnd(keyValidityEndDateForOrigination) |
| .setKeyValidityForConsumptionEnd(keyValidityEndDateForConsumption) |
| .setRandomizedEncryptionRequired(false) |
| .setSignaturePaddings(KeyProperties.SIGNATURE_PADDING_RSA_PKCS1, |
| KeyProperties.SIGNATURE_PADDING_RSA_PSS) |
| .setUserAuthenticationRequired(true) |
| .setUserAuthenticationValidityDurationSeconds(123456) |
| .build(); |
| |
| assertEquals( |
| KeyProperties.PURPOSE_DECRYPT| KeyProperties.PURPOSE_VERIFY, spec.getPurposes()); |
| MoreAsserts.assertContentsInOrder(Arrays.asList(spec.getBlockModes()), |
| KeyProperties.BLOCK_MODE_GCM, KeyProperties.BLOCK_MODE_CTR); |
| assertTrue(spec.isDigestsSpecified()); |
| MoreAsserts.assertContentsInOrder(Arrays.asList(spec.getDigests()), |
| KeyProperties.DIGEST_SHA256, KeyProperties.DIGEST_SHA512); |
| MoreAsserts.assertContentsInOrder(Arrays.asList(spec.getEncryptionPaddings()), |
| KeyProperties.ENCRYPTION_PADDING_RSA_PKCS1, KeyProperties.ENCRYPTION_PADDING_PKCS7); |
| assertEquals(keyValidityStartDate, spec.getKeyValidityStart()); |
| assertEquals(keyValidityEndDateForOrigination, spec.getKeyValidityForOriginationEnd()); |
| assertEquals(keyValidityEndDateForConsumption, spec.getKeyValidityForConsumptionEnd()); |
| assertFalse(spec.isRandomizedEncryptionRequired()); |
| MoreAsserts.assertContentsInOrder(Arrays.asList(spec.getSignaturePaddings()), |
| KeyProperties.SIGNATURE_PADDING_RSA_PKCS1, KeyProperties.SIGNATURE_PADDING_RSA_PSS); |
| assertTrue(spec.isUserAuthenticationRequired()); |
| assertEquals(123456, spec.getUserAuthenticationValidityDurationSeconds()); |
| } |
| |
| public void testSetKeyValidityEndDateAppliesToBothEndDates() { |
| Date date = new Date(System.currentTimeMillis() + 555555); |
| KeyProtection spec = new KeyProtection.Builder( |
| KeyProperties.PURPOSE_SIGN) |
| .setKeyValidityEnd(date) |
| .build(); |
| assertEquals(date, spec.getKeyValidityForOriginationEnd()); |
| assertEquals(date, spec.getKeyValidityForConsumptionEnd()); |
| } |
